#d8cace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8cace is composed of 84.7% red, 79.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 342.9 degrees, a saturation of 15.2% and a lightness of 82%. #d8cace color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1959d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d8cace color description : Grayish pink.
#d8cace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8cace has RGB values of R:216, G:202,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.05,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14207694.
